Cucumber Melon Misty:
(Can you tell I was inspired by the popular Cucumber Melon scented powders, lotions and perfumes?)
1 large cucumber pealed and quartered
2 large slices of honeydew
1 c. green seedless grapes
1/2 c. apple juice
1/2 tsp. Vitamin C powder
1/2 tsp. flax seed
1 Tbsp. Agave
Pulverize in a juicer or Vita-Mix. Enjoy!

The last thing I want to mention is what I've been eating for lunch the past couple of days. I've been listening to the book Doctor Yourself
by Andrew Saul (info here), and he is continually praising the benefits of vegetable juicing. Unfortunately, I'm not a big veggie fan, except of course about Larry and Bob! Despite this, I decided to give it a try. Since he talked about fruit juicing too, I combined the two to make a more palatable drink for myself. Gotta tell you, it was quite yummy and satisfying.
I tossed in my Vita Mix blender (this is an awesome blender, it can pulverize and juice pretty much anything) the following items:
1/2 c. pure blueberry juice
1 whole cucumber (peeled and halved)
1 1/2 c. strawberries (tops and all, just rinsed them)
3 stalks of celery (washed and chopped in medium size pieces)
1 c. frozen raspberries
1/4 c. frozen blueberries
1 Tbsp Agave
1 Tbsp Flax Seed
1/2 tsp Vitamin C
Blend til pulverized into a beautiful smoothie! It was delicious. Next week I'll experiment with some other veggies, but the cucumber and celery was as brave as I got for the first time 'round.
The only drawback to this type of smoothie, was that it didn't last. It was very filling at the time and I felt no need to eat anything else, but I was quite hungry and craving protein a few hours later. Hmmm, any suggestions?
